Buttons
Control Buttons
Button
Description
Turns the product on or off.
Hold down the power button on the side of the product for about 2 seconds.
MENU
Opens the on-screen menu and exits from the menu.
VOL +, VOL -
Push the button to adjust volume.
,
,
,
These buttons allow you to adjust items in the menu.
ENTER
Activates a highlighted menu item.
BACK
Use this button to step one step back in the menu.
